Transaction e3afc489a9601f6c5567a3ec85ee4ae8c71a595eb77d0df321dcbb93c7c4373a
1 Input
1 Output
-
e3afc489a9601f6c5567a3ec85ee4ae8c71a595eb77d0df321dcbb93c7c4373a:0
- value
- 26355
- script pubkey
- OP_0 OP_PUSHBYTES_20 a44e8d8eaa786d898799d4410a5de18599afe552
- address
- bc1q538gmr420pkcnpue63qs5h0pskv6le2jdlfrpv